Cobi Jones has gone from a walk-on at UCLA to a permanent spot as a midfielder the Galaxy, has the most appearances ever by a US National Team Player and is a member of GolNoir's MLS' All-Time Best Black 11.

A High School teammate of Eric Wynalda, the USA's all time leading scorer, Cobi turned his walk-on spot into All-American status and competed on the 1992 Olympic team with, among others, Alexi Lalas. However he really came into consciousness as a member of the 1994 World Cup Team of the United States. He appeared in all 4 games during that tournament and turned it into a short lived stint at Coventry City, making him the first African-American to play in the English Premiere League. He even scored in his first league match. However a coaching change left him out of favor and he returned to the US. A deal with famed Brazillian club Vasco de Gama fell through. Thankfully, MLS started in 1996 and Cobi was allocated back home to LA to play with the Galaxy.

He's been one of the major reasons LA has been one of the top teams in MLS since its inception. His best year was in 1998 when he scored 19 times and had 13 assists and led LA to MLS' best record, only to be upset in the playoffs by Chicago.

Cobi's pace, tenacity and work rate are major reasons why he is so good, but he has steadily added the ability to beat players on the wing with the dribble and set up his fellow midfielders and forwards.

An active reader who is interested in being a lawyer when his playing days are done, Cobi has also found time to host a show on MTV and was regularly featured in ESPN advertisements for MLS.
